Wood siding repl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ated wooden siding and installing new panels to restore the exterior appearance and structural integrity of a property. This process typically includes assessing the condition of existing siding, carefully removing compromised sections, and fitting new wood siding that matches the existing style and dimensions. Skilled service providers ensure that the replacement work is seamless, helping to improve the overall look of the property while providing a durable barrier against external elements.
These services address common problems such as rotting, warping, cracking, or insect damage that can compromise the effectiveness and appearance of wood siding. Over time, exposure to moisture, pests, and weather conditions can lead to significant deterioration, making replacement necessary to prevent further damage and costly repairs. Replacing damaged siding can also enhance energy efficiency by providing better insulation and reducing drafts, which helps maintain consistent indoor temperatures.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for wood siding replacement typ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the type of wood selected. For example, cedar siding might cost around $8 per square foot, while pine could be closer to $4. Variations in wood quality and style influence the overall expense.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ing wood siding usually fall between $2 and $6 per square foot. This range accounts for removal of old siding, preparation, and installation by local service providers in areas like Mocksville, NC. Complex projects or higher labor rates can increase total costs.
Project Size Impact - Larger siding replacement projects tend to have a lower per-square-foot cost due to economies of scale, with total expenses potentially ranging from $1,500 to $8,000. Smaller projects, such as partial replacements, may cost between $500 and $2,500 depending on scope.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include repairs to underlying structures or finishing work, which can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These costs vary based on the condition of existing surfaces and the extent of prep work need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
